Race 4 Jumbo Prize (5-2) His debut race for the Casper Fownes barn while getting the services of defending and leading rider Zac Purton, and with him on board the betting public unloaded on him sending him off as the 7-5 favourite. He broke well but heading into the short turn he started fighting Zac for the bit, and a tugging war commenced the entire backstretch. He was in tight going two wide in the turn then entering the stretch Purton moved him to the 5 path but his inexperience started to show and raced very green while caught up in traffic. He started to fade with 100 metres left but the most important aspect was Zac never really asked for him to run, a couple love taps on his shoulder and one whack on his hip but nothing other than that.

Race 6 Fat Turtle (3-1) He won his first try in Hong Kong in an all out battle with Split Of A Second after winning 3 out of 6 races in his homeland of Australia. In here he had two strikes against him before the gates opened, he drew the 13 hole and the undefeated Champion's Way for John Size. He broke well and went straight for the lead while being bothered by Leung on Gintoki who broke just outside him, it took Teetan 500 metres (halfway thru the turn) to get his position over to the rail. All the while this was going on Moreira was sitting and waiting to pounce on the chalk right behind the duel going on, he didn't have much for the winner but did dig in after he was passed, a nice effort considering the circumstances he had to endure. Hopefully he'll get a better draw and not that monster he had to face here next time out.

Race 8 Golden Dash (11-1) Went off as the second betting choice behind Voyage King, at the break he was a step slow then was bumped around by the favourite and eventual winner High Five losing a couple lengths to the field. Entering the stretch he was boxed in on the rail in the third flight behind the duel going on in the front end, mid-stretch he was very hesitant splitting the two front runners that were beginning to tire, then again didn’t want to go thru on the rail. Afterwards was passed in the stretch by two closers finishing less than two lengths off of them, not a bad finish considering that he severely bled in the race.
